Event Description

Writing a proposal is not just about presenting information — it is about convincing decision-makers that your idea is the best solution to their problem.

This 1-day Proposal Writing Workshop is designed to help professionals, entrepreneurs, consultants, project managers, NGO staff, and business owners create clear, persuasive, and result-oriented proposals. Participants will learn how to structure proposals, write with confidence, align with evaluator expectations, and improve their success rate in winning contracts, funding, or approvals.

Through practical examples, guided exercises, and proven frameworks, this workshop helps you move from idea to impact — producing proposals that stand out in competitive environments.

By the end of the day, participants will understand how to plan, write, review, and finalize professional proposals that communicate value, credibility, and clarity.
